The Oceanography Society (TOS) meetings, starting with the inaugural meeting in Monterey in 1989, have become recognized for their unique non-concurrent plenary sessions followed by contributed posters designed to highlight specific science results relevant to the plenary sessions. The plenary session talks are designed for interdisciplinary audiences to excite and interest the broad spectrum of scientific and technical expertise within the oceanographic community.
